CPS Employee Says Supervisor Sexually Harassed Her Repeatedly

CHICAGO (CBS) — A woman who works for the Chicago School Board is suing her employer and her supervisor claiming she was regularly sexually harassed at work for more than a year.

As WBBM Newsradio’s David Roe reports, the woman filed suit against the Board of Education Thursday in U.S. District Court. She says her supervisor sent her sexually suggestive messages and made inappropriate sexual comment, and even made her change her work habits so he could be around her more.

The woman, who works as a youth outreach worker for the Board of Education, claims her supervisor repeatedly told her the way she looked and smelled would make him “do something” to her.
